vaadin-scroller[slot=drawer]{padding:var(--lumo-space-s)}vaadin-side-nav-item vaadin-icon{padding:0}[slot=drawer]:is(header,footer){display:flex;align-items:center;gap:var(--lumo-space-s);padding:var(--lumo-space-s) var(--lumo-space-m);min-height:var(--lumo-size-xl);box-sizing:border-box}[slot=drawer]:is(header,footer):is(:empty){display:none}.custom-flex{display:grid!important;grid-template-columns:repeat(10,1fr)}.custom-grid-cards{display:grid}.horizontal-layout-responsive{background-color:#fff!important}.cursor-customize{cursor:auto!important}.cursor-customize:hover{cursor:pointer!important}.content-modal-custom{display:grid;grid-template-columns:repeat(3,1fr)}@media (min-width: 300px) and (max-width: 600px){.horizontal-layout-responsive{background-color:red!important}.content-modal-custom{display:flex;flex-direction:column}}@media (min-width: 600px) and (max-width: 800px){.content-modal-custom{display:grid;grid-template-columns:repeat(2,1fr)}}@media (max-width: 1000px){.custom-grid-cards{display:grid!important;grid-template-columns:repeat(3,1fr)!important}}@media (max-width: 850px){.custom-flex{display:flex!important;flex-direction:column!important}.custom-grid-cards{grid-template-columns:repeat(4,1fr)!important}}@media (min-height: 999px){.custom-height-vertical-layout{height:95%!important;overflow-y:auto}}.item{flex-grow:1}.item:nth-child(1){flex-basis:60%}.item:nth-child(2){flex-basis:10%}.item:nth-child(3){flex-basis:20%}.item:nth-child(4){flex-basis:10%}vaadin-button{cursor:pointer!important}:root{--lumo-base-color: #ffffff;--lumo-contrast-40pct: rgba(0, 0, 0, .4);--lumo-space-s: .5rem;--lumo-space-m: 1rem;--lumo-size-xl: 3rem}vaadin-grid::part(header-cell){font-size:1rem;font-weight:900}.responsive-aside{width:100%;box-sizing:border-box;padding:.25rem;background-color:var(--lumo-contrast-5pct);border-radius:var(--lumo-border-radius-l);position:sticky;top:0;overflow-y:auto;overflow-x:hidden;flex-shrink:0}@media (min-width: 768px){.responsive-aside{flex-shrink:0;flex-grow:0}}.responsive-list{width:100%;margin:0;padding:0;list-style:none}.responsive-list-item{display:grid;font-size:x-small;grid-template-columns:minmax(0,40fr) minmax(75px,25fr) minmax(62.5px,20fr) minmax(min-content,15fr);column-gap:.675rem;align-items:center;width:100%;height:3.75rem;overflow-x:hidden}.resp-col-1{overflow:hidden;white-space:nowrap;min-width:0;display:flex;flex-direction:column;justify-content:center}.resp-col-2{display:flex;align-items:center;justify-content:center;min-width:0}.resp-col-2 vaadin-integer-field{display:inline-flex;align-items:center;box-sizing:border-box;flex:1 1 auto;min-width:0}.resp-col-2 vaadin-integer-field::part(input-field){flex:1 1 auto;min-width:0;overflow:hidden;text-overflow:ellipsis;white-space:nowrap;padding:0;text-align:center}.resp-col-2 vaadin-integer-field::part(decrease-button),.resp-col-2 vaadin-integer-field::part(increase-button){flex:0 0 auto;width:var(--lumo-size-xs);height:var(--lumo-size-xs);margin:0;padding:0}.resp-col-3{display:flex;align-items:center;justify-content:center;min-width:0}.resp-col-3 vaadin-number-field{display:inline-flex;align-items:center;box-sizing:border-box;min-width:0;width:100%;max-width:100%;height:100%}.resp-col-3 vaadin-number-field::part(input-field){flex:1 1 auto;min-width:0;overflow:hidden;text-overflow:ellipsis;white-space:nowrap;margin:0;padding:0;text-align:center}.resp-col-3 vaadin-number-field::part(decrease-button),.resp-col-3 vaadin-number-field::part(increase-button){flex:0 0 auto;width:var(--lumo-size-xs);height:var(--lumo-size-xs);margin:0;padding:0}.resp-col-4{min-width:0;display:flex;align-items:center;justify-content:center;flex:0 0 auto}.delete-button{padding:0;color:#fff;display:flex;align-items:center;background-color:red;justify-content:center;border-radius:.25rem;box-sizing:border-box}.delete-button vaadin-icon{width:1.5rem;height:1.5rem}.card{display:flex;flex-direction:row;align-items:flex-start;justify-content:space-between;border:1px solid #ddd;border-radius:8px;overflow:hidden;background-color:#fff;box-shadow:0 4px 6px #0000001a;transition:transform .3s ease;padding:16px;height:25rem}.card:hover{transform:translateY(-5px)}.card-content{font-size:1.094rem;color:#555;margin:5px}.p-os-view{padding:2px;box-sizing:border-box;display:block;position:relative;height:100%;overflow-y:auto;--cv-blue: 212 96% 54%;--cv-purple: 259 97% 66%;--cv-dropzone-border-color: hsl(var(--cv-blue) / .5);--cv-dropzone-bg-color: hsl(var(--cv-blue) / .2);--cv-droptarget-border-color: hsl(var(--cv-purple) / 1);--cv-droptarget-bg-color: hsl(var(--cv-purple) / .4);--cv-stripe-width: 1.5px;--cv-stripe-gap: 9px;--cv-stripe-color: hsl(var(--cv-blue) / .2);--cv-layout-border-color: var(--lumo-contrast-40pct);--cv-checkerboard-color1: hsl(0 0% 0% / .05);--cv-checkerboard-color2: hsl(0 0% 100% / .05);--cv-checkerboard-size: 16px}.p-os-view[dragging]{--cv-checkerboard-color1: hsl(var(--cv-blue) / .2);--cv-checkerboard-color2: hsl(var(--cv-blue) / .1);--cv-layout-border-color: var(--cv-dropzone-border-color)}.p-os-view .preview-container{display:contents}.p-os-view .preview-container>.layout[style*="align-self: stretch"]{width:100%}.p-os-view .preview-container>.layout[style*="flex-grow: 1"]{height:100%}.p-os-view[dragging] .layout:not([style*="gap:"]){gap:8px}.p-os-view[dragging] .layout:not([style*="padding:"],[empty]){padding:8px}.p-os-view .cover-overlay{position:absolute;border-radius:1px}.p-os-view:not([starting-drag]) .cover-overlay.editable-hovering{outline:2px solid hsl(var(--cv-blue) / 1);outline-offset:-1px}.p-os-view:not([starting-drag]) .cover-overlay.editable-editing{outline:1px solid hsl(var(--cv-blue) / 1);outline-offset:-1px;box-shadow:inset 0 0 0 2px var(--lumo-base-color)}.p-os-view .overlays,.p-os-view .drop-zones{position:absolute;top:0;left:0;width:100%;height:100%;z-index:1}.p-os-view:not([dragging]) .drop-zones{pointer-events:none}.p-os-view .drop-zone{position:absolute;box-sizing:border-box;border-radius:1px;min-height:10px;min-width:10px}.p-os-view[dragging] .drop-zone:not([empty-layout]){outline:1px dashed var(--cv-dropzone-border-color);outline-offset:-2px;background-color:var(--cv-dropzone-bg-color)}.p-os-view .drop-zone[remaining-space]{background:repeating-linear-gradient(-45deg,var(--cv-stripe-color),var(--cv-stripe-color) var(--cv-stripe-width),transparent var(--cv-stripe-width),transparent var(--cv-stripe-gap))}.p-os-view[dragging] .drop-zone[drag-over]{background:var(--cv-droptarget-bg-color);outline:1px solid var(--cv-droptarget-border-color);outline-offset:-1px;box-shadow:inset 0 0 0 2px var(--lumo-base-color)}.p-os-view:not([readonly]) .layout[empty],vaadin-form-layout[empty]{border-radius:1px;background:repeating-conic-gradient(var(--cv-checkerboard-color1) 0% 25%,var(--cv-checkerboard-color2) 0% 50%) 50% / var(--cv-checkerboard-size) var(--cv-checkerboard-size);background-clip:content-box;outline:1px dashed var(--cv-layout-border-color);outline-offset:-2px}.p-os-view[dragging]:not([readonly]) vaadin-form-layout[empty]{background:transparent}.p-os-view .layout[empty]:before{content:"";display:block;min-width:64px;min-height:32px}.p-os-view[readonly] .drop-zones,.p-os-view[readonly] .overlays,.p-os-view[inline-editing] .drop-zones,.p-os-view[inline-editing] .overlays{display:none}.p-os-view .content-wrapper[contenteditable=true]{display:inline-block;overflow:hidden;width:100%}.p-os-view[dragging] vaadin-form-layout{padding:8px}.p-os-view vaadin-form-layout[empty]:before{content:"";display:block;min-width:64px;min-height:32px}.p-os-view[dragging] vaadin-form-layout:not([empty]):after{content:"";display:block;min-width:64px;min-height:32px}.login-view{padding:2px;box-sizing:border-box;display:block;position:relative;height:100%;overflow-y:auto;--cv-blue: 212 96% 54%;--cv-purple: 259 97% 66%;--cv-dropzone-border-color: hsl(var(--cv-blue) / .5);--cv-dropzone-bg-color: hsl(var(--cv-blue) / .2);--cv-droptarget-border-color: hsl(var(--cv-purple) / 1);--cv-droptarget-bg-color: hsl(var(--cv-purple) / .4);--cv-stripe-width: 1.5px;--cv-stripe-gap: 9px;--cv-stripe-color: hsl(var(--cv-blue) / .2);--cv-layout-border-color: var(--lumo-contrast-40pct);--cv-checkerboard-color1: hsl(0 0% 0% / .05);--cv-checkerboard-color2: hsl(0 0% 100% / .05);--cv-checkerboard-size: 16px}.login-view[dragging]{--cv-checkerboard-color1: hsl(var(--cv-blue) / .2);--cv-checkerboard-color2: hsl(var(--cv-blue) / .1);--cv-layout-border-color: var(--cv-dropzone-border-color)}.login-view .preview-container{display:contents}.login-view .preview-container>.layout[style*="align-self: stretch"]{width:100%}.login-view .preview-container>.layout[style*="flex-grow: 1"]{height:100%}.login-view[dragging] .layout:not([style*="gap:"]){gap:8px}.login-view[dragging] .layout:not([style*="padding:"],[empty]){padding:8px}.login-view .cover-overlay{position:absolute;border-radius:1px}.login-view:not([starting-drag]) .cover-overlay.editable-hovering{outline:2px solid hsl(var(--cv-blue) / 1);outline-offset:-1px}.login-view:not([starting-drag]) .cover-overlay.editable-editing{outline:1px solid hsl(var(--cv-blue) / 1);outline-offset:-1px;box-shadow:inset 0 0 0 2px var(--lumo-base-color)}.login-view .overlays,.login-view .drop-zones{position:absolute;top:0;left:0;width:100%;height:100%;z-index:1}.login-view:not([dragging]) .drop-zones{pointer-events:none}.login-view .drop-zone{position:absolute;box-sizing:border-box;border-radius:1px;min-height:10px;min-width:10px}.login-view[dragging] .drop-zone:not([empty-layout]){outline:1px dashed var(--cv-dropzone-border-color);outline-offset:-2px;background-color:var(--cv-dropzone-bg-color)}.login-view .drop-zone[remaining-space]{background:repeating-linear-gradient(-45deg,var(--cv-stripe-color),var(--cv-stripe-color) var(--cv-stripe-width),transparent var(--cv-stripe-width),transparent var(--cv-stripe-gap))}.login-view[dragging] .drop-zone[drag-over]{background:var(--cv-droptarget-bg-color);outline:1px solid var(--cv-droptarget-border-color);outline-offset:-1px;box-shadow:inset 0 0 0 2px var(--lumo-base-color)}.drop-zone[empty-layout]{z-index:-1}.login-view:not([readonly]) .layout[empty],vaadin-form-layout[empty]{border-radius:1px;background:repeating-conic-gradient(var(--cv-checkerboard-color1) 0% 25%,var(--cv-checkerboard-color2) 0% 50%) 50% / var(--cv-checkerboard-size) var(--cv-checkerboard-size);background-clip:content-box;outline:1px dashed var(--cv-layout-border-color);outline-offset:-2px}.login-view[dragging]:not([readonly]) vaadin-form-layout[empty]{background:transparent}.login-view .layout[empty]:before{content:"";display:block;min-width:64px;min-height:32px}.login-view[readonly] .drop-zones,.login-view[readonly] .overlays,.login-view[inline-editing] .drop-zones,.login-view[inline-editing] .overlays{display:none}.login-view .content-wrapper[contenteditable=true]{display:inline-block;overflow:hidden;width:100%}.login-view[dragging] vaadin-form-layout{padding:8px}.login-view vaadin-form-layout[empty]:before{content:"";display:block;min-width:64px;min-height:32px}.login-view[dragging] vaadin-form-layout:not([empty]):after{content:"";display:block;min-width:64px;min-height:32px}.gallery div{flex:1 1 calc(20% - 10px)}@media (max-width: 320px){.gallery div{flex:1 1 calc(100% - 10px)}}@media (min-width: 321px) and (max-width: 480px){.gallery div{flex:1 1 calc(50% - 10px)}}@media (min-width: 481px) and (max-width: 768px){.gallery div{flex:1 1 calc(100% / 3 - 10px)}}@media (min-width: 769px) and (max-width: 1024px){.gallery div{flex:1 1 calc(25% - 10px)}}@media (min-width: 1025px){.gallery div{flex:1 1 calc(20% - 10px)}}.settings-view{max-width:1200px;margin:0 auto;padding:var(--lumo-space-m)}.settings-header{flex-direction:row;justify-content:space-between;align-items:center}.settings-tabs{overflow-x:auto;white-space:nowrap}.settings-content{max-width:100%}.config-field{flex-direction:row;align-items:flex-start;gap:var(--lumo-space-m)}.config-info{flex:0 0 250px;min-width:200px}.settings-field,.settings-combo{flex:1;min-width:200px}.image-upload-field{width:100%}.image-field-layout{flex-direction:row;align-items:center}.image-preview{align-self:center}.upload-dialog{max-width:90vw;width:500px}.settings-subheader{font-size:var(--lumo-font-size-l);margin-top:var(--lumo-space-l);margin-bottom:var(--lumo-space-m)}@media (max-width: 768px){.settings-view{padding:var(--lumo-space-s)}.settings-header{flex-direction:column;align-items:stretch;gap:var(--lumo-space-m)}.config-field{flex-direction:column;align-items:stretch}.config-info{flex:none;width:100%}.settings-field,.settings-combo{width:100%;margin-top:var(--lumo-space-s)}.image-field-layout{flex-direction:column;align-items:stretch;gap:var(--lumo-space-s)}.image-preview{align-self:center;max-width:100%;height:auto}.upload-dialog{width:95vw;max-width:none}.settings-subheader{font-size:var(--lumo-font-size-m)}}@media (max-width: 480px){.settings-view{padding:var(--lumo-space-xs)}.config-field{padding:var(--lumo-space-s);gap:var(--lumo-space-s)}.settings-subheader{font-size:var(--lumo-font-size-s)}}
